Texas Rangers @
Minnesota Twins
1981-09-27 Β· Day game Β· Metropolitan Stadium Β· Att: 4428 Β· 56Β°F, cloudy, dry Β· Wind 29 mph Β· 2:20
Minnesota Twins defeated Texas Rangers 5β2. Minnesota Twins put up 3 in the 7th. Pete Redfern earned the win and Doug Corbett picked up the save.
